How much do part time weekend project man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average yearly pay for part time weekend project manager in Appleton, WI is $102,477.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$81,000.00 and $125,400.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How do part time weekend project managers typically balance responsibilities across multiple projects with limited weekly hours?

Part Time Weekend Project Managers often oversee several projects concurrently, requiring strong organizational skills and clear prioritization. Given the condensed schedule, they typically rely on detailed planning, effective delegation, and frequent check-ins with team members during the week to keep projects on track. Success in this role often depends on proactive communication and leveraging digital project management tools to ensure visibility and accountability. Collaborating closely with weekday project leads and stakeholders is essential to address issues promptly and maintain project momentum.

What is a part time weekend project manager?

Part time weekend project managers are professionals who oversee and coordinate projects, but work primarily on weekends and often for fewer hours than a standard full-time schedule. Their responsibilities include planning, executing, and closing projects, managing teams, and ensuring that project goals are met within specified timelines and budgets. This role is ideal for individuals who have other commitments during the week or for organizations that operate on a weekend schedule. These managers must possess strong organizational and communication skills to lead teams and drive projects to successful completion during limited hours. Depending on the industry, they may also handle tasks such as reporting, risk management, and stakeholder communication.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time weekend project man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Weekend Project Manager, you need strong organizational, leadership, and time-management skills, typically supported by a background in project management and relevant experience. Familiarity with project management tools like Microsoft Project, Trello, or Asana, and certifications such as PMP or CAPM, are often valuable. Excellent communication, adaptability, and problem-solving abilities help you effectively coordinate teams and handle issues that arise outside standard work hours. These skills and qualities are essential for ensuring project progress and team cohesion during limited weekend hours.
